1. The Shrinking Potato | 土豆条缩小之谜
A student placed identical potato cylinders into three beakers: one with pure water, one with 10% sucrose solution, and one with 25% sucrose solution. After 30 minutes, the potato in pure water became slightly longer and very firm. The potato in 10% sucrose became a little shorter and softer. The potato in 25% sucrose became much shorter and very floppy.

The water moved by osmosis. The potato cells contain a certain amount of dissolved substances, so their cytoplasm has a lower water potential than pure water. Water entered the cells in pure water by osmosis, making them turgid. In the sugar solutions, the water potential outside the cells was lower (more concentrated), so water left the cells by osmosis, causing them to become flaccid. The higher the sucrose concentration, the greater the water loss.

This case reminds you that osmosis is a special type of diffusion – the net movement of water molecules through a partially permeable membrane from a region of higher water potential (dilute solution) to a region of lower water potential (concentrated solution). In exam questions, always mention the partially permeable cell membrane and compare water potentials.

2. The Sailor with Bleeding Gums | 牙龈出血的水手
A historical report describes sailors on a long sea voyage who had no fresh fruit or vegetables for months. They developed swollen, bleeding gums, their wounds healed slowly, and they felt very weak. The ship’s doctor suspected a dietary deficiency.

The symptoms point to a lack of vitamin C (ascorbic acid), which causes scurvy. Vitamin C is needed to make collagen, a protein that helps keep skin, gums, and blood vessels healthy. Without it, capillaries become fragile and bleed easily. Fresh citrus fruits, tomatoes, and green vegetables are rich sources of vitamin C.

This case links to food tests: vitamin C can be detected using DCPIP solution, which turns from blue to colourless when ascorbic acid is present. A balanced diet must include vitamins and minerals alongside carbohydrates, proteins, and fats to prevent deficiency diseases.

3. The Model Gut Investigation | 肠道模型探究
A class used a model ‘gut’ – a Visking tubing bag containing starch solution and amylase enzyme, suspended in a water bath at 37 °C. The surrounding water was tested every minute with iodine solution and Benedict’s reagent. Initially, the water outside gave a blue-black colour with iodine, but after 20 minutes no starch was detected outside. However, the outside water did give an orange-red precipitate with Benedict’s reagent after heating.

Amylase breaks down starch into smaller sugar molecules, mainly maltose. Starch molecules are too large to pass through the Visking tubing (which mimics the partially permeable membrane of the small intestine), but the smaller sugar molecules can diffuse out. That is why starch was not found outside but reducing sugar was present. The colour change from blue-black to no colour with iodine inside the tubing confirmed starch digestion.

In exams, you should explain why temperature matters: 37 °C is the optimum for human enzymes, providing the best kinetic energy for enzyme-substrate collisions without denaturing the enzyme. This model demonstrates digestion and absorption, two key stages in human nutrition.

4. The Athlete’s Breathing Rate | 运动员的呼吸频率
A student measured her breathing rate at rest: 16 breaths per minute. After running on the spot for two minutes, her breathing rate immediately increased to 32 breaths per minute. Even after five minutes of rest, her rate was still 20 breaths per minute.

During exercise, muscle cells respire more rapidly to release energy for contraction. Aerobic respiration requires oxygen and produces carbon dioxide. The increased breathing rate brings in more oxygen and removes excess CO₂ faster. The equation for aerobic respiration can be summarised as: C₆H₁₂O₆ + 6O₂ → 6CO₂ + 6H₂O (+ energy). The slower recovery shows that the body still needed extra oxygen to break down lactic acid produced during anaerobic respiration when oxygen delivery lagged behind demand.

You should be able to link heart rate and breathing rate to gas exchange and the circulatory system. When answering such case studies, always connect the demand for energy with oxygen supply and waste removal.

5. The Bubbling Pondweed | 冒泡的水草
A piece of pondweed was placed in a beaker of water with a lamp at different distances. The number of oxygen bubbles released per minute was counted. At 10 cm, 45 bubbles; at 20 cm, 30 bubbles; at 40 cm, 12 bubbles; and in the dark, 0 bubbles.

The bubbles contain oxygen produced during photosynthesis. The rate of photosynthesis decreases as the distance from the light source increases because light intensity decreases. In the dark, no photosynthesis occurs, so no oxygen bubbles are produced. The equation for photosynthesis is: 6CO₂ + 6H₂O → C₆H₁₂O₆ + 6O₂, showing light energy is essential.

Exam questions might ask you to identify the independent variable (light intensity), dependent variable (number of bubbles), and control variables (temperature, CO₂ concentration, type of pondweed). This classic experiment tests how a limiting factor affects the rate of photosynthesis.

6. The Disappearing Mice | 消失的老鼠
In a grassland food web, owls hunt mice, and mice eat seeds from grass and grains. One year, a disease killed many owls. Scientists observed that the mouse population first increased rapidly, then after a few months began to decline. At the same time, the vegetation cover decreased.

Owls are predators of mice. When owl numbers dropped, fewer mice were eaten, so the mouse population boomed. As more mice fed on seeds, the grass and grain plants were overgrazed, reducing their biomass. This created food shortage for the mice, causing their population to crash. This is a classic predator-prey cycle and demonstrates interdependence within an ecosystem.

You must be able to interpret graphs of predator-prey relationships and explain why populations change over time. Always refer to competition for resources and feeding relationships.

7. The Earlobe Family Tree | 耳垂家族树
The diagram shows a family pedigree for attached (A) and free (F) earlobes. Free earlobes are dominant. In the first generation, the father has attached earlobes and the mother has free earlobes. They have three children: two sons with free earlobes, and one daughter with attached earlobes.

Let F represent the free earlobe allele (dominant) and a represent the attached allele (recessive). The father with attached earlobes must be aa. The mother with free earlobes could be Ff or FF, but because she had a daughter with attached earlobes (aa), she must be heterozygous Ff. The free-earlobe sons are Ff, inheriting F from mother and a from father. This case demonstrates how recessive traits can skip a generation and how parents’ genotypes can be deduced from offspring phenotypes.

In Year 8, you should be comfortable using simple Punnett squares and genetic diagrams to predict ratios. This case helps you practise interpreting family pedigree charts, a common exam skill.

8. The Variegated Leaf Starch Test | 彩叶淀粉测试
A variegated geranium leaf with green and white patches was exposed to sunlight for several hours. It was then boiled in water, warmed in ethanol to remove chlorophyll, and tested with iodine solution. The green areas turned blue-black; the white areas remained pale brown/yellow.

Photosynthesis produces glucose, which is stored as starch. The green areas contain chlorophyll, which captures light energy needed for photosynthesis. The white areas lack chlorophyll, so no starch was produced there. This investigation provides evidence that chlorophyll is essential for photosynthesis. The ethanol step removes the green colour so that the iodine’s colour change is visible.

You may be asked to explain why boiling ethanol is used instead of water: ethanol dissolves chlorophyll but is flammable, so it must be heated indirectly in a water bath. Safety and fair testing are key aspects of such experimental case studies.

9. The Sweet Taste of Chewing Bread | 咀嚼面包的甜味
A student chewed a piece of plain white bread for two minutes without swallowing. She noticed that the bread began to taste slightly sweet. She spat out the bolus and added a few drops of iodine solution; the result was a much lighter brown colour compared to unchewed bread tested with iodine.

Bread contains starch, which is a polysaccharide. Saliva contains the enzyme salivary amylase, which starts digesting starch into maltose, a disaccharide sugar. Maltose tastes sweet. The iodine test for starch becomes weaker (lighter brown rather than blue-black) because some starch has been broken down. This is a simple model of chemical digestion that begins in the mouth.

In case study questions, you should link the enzyme to its substrate and product, and note that mechanical digestion (chewing) also increases surface area, aiding enzymatic action. This real-life observation makes a memorable connection to digestive system studies.

10. The Polluted Pond Survey | 污染池塘调查
A biologist sampled two ponds. Pond X had crystal clear water with stonefly nymphs, mayfly nymphs, and freshwater shrimps. Pond Y had cloudy water, green algae scum, and only rat-tailed maggots, sludge worms, and bloodworms. The biologist recorded the numbers of each species and concluded that Pond Y was heavily polluted.

Some aquatic invertebrates are very sensitive to oxygen levels and pollution. Stonefly and mayfly nymphs require high oxygen concentrations and are intolerant of pollution; they are indicator species for clean water. Rat-tailed maggots and sludge worms can survive in low-oxygen, polluted water. The absence of sensitive species and presence of tolerant species in Pond Y strongly suggests organic pollution, which depletes dissolved oxygen as bacteria decompose the waste.

This case emphasises the use of biological indicators and environmental data to assess ecosystem health. You may be asked to interpret tables of species abundance and infer the level of pollution.
